DIVERSIFICATION
diversification,n.1. A company’s movement into a broader range of products, usu. by buying
firms already serving the market or by expanding existing operations <the soft-drink company’s
diversification into the potato-chip market has increased its profits>.2. The act of investing in a
wide range of companies to reduce the risk if one sector of the market suffers losses <the prudent
investor’s diversification of the portfolio among 12 companies>. — diversify,vb. [Blacks Law 8th]
